Police kill robbery suspect
One of the suspected armed robbers


Men of the Nigerian Police from ‘B’ Division in Asaba in concert with a local vigilante have gunned down an armed robbery suspect around Port Gold Iyiabi Street, Asaba, Delta State.

The dead robbery suspect with members of his gang reportedly attacked occupants of Port Gold Iyiabi Street and on sighting the security team, engaged them in a shootout. It was in the course of the shootout that the unidentified armed robber was killed, while other members of his gang escaped.

According to a statement by the Police Public Relations Officer, Delta State Command, DSP. Celestina Kalu, items recovered from the hoodlums include two cut-to-size locally made pistols and ten expended cartridges.

In similar vein, Police operatives at Agbor Division also in Delta State have arrested a robbery suspect, Lucky Okwunwa, while the other member of his gang, Confidence Ojieh was picked up at a nearby bush.

They were said to be operating along Owanta Street by Alisimiya, Boji-Boji, Agbor when the Police operatives who received a distress call mobilized to the scene.

The Police in Ozoro Division and the local vigilante in the area have also arrested a suspected armed robber and recovered one locally made cut-to-size gun as well as a face mask from him.

Meanwhile, following information that one Godspower Edward of Okwagbe in Ughelli South Local Government of Delta State was seen with a suspected stolen tricycle with Reg. No. AYB 957 QC, detectives from Otu-Jeremi Division reportedly swung into action and arrested the said Godspower Edward.

According to a Police statement, on interrogation, the suspect disclosed that he bought the said tricycle from one Biris Tyarede of Nokara in Burutu Local Government Area.

The statement added that the said Biris Tyarede was later seen at Okwagbe with another tricycle with registration No. BKW 129 QB and he was promptly arrested. He allegedly confessed that he stole the tricycle from Oghara and Warri respectively.

Police say he will soon be arraigned in court at the end of the investigation.
